The multi-device login feature of Meta-owned WhatsApp now allows users to use the same WhatsApp account on multiple phones.
Users can now link up to four additional devices to their phones.
According to IANS, this update has begun rolling out to users worldwide and will be available to everyone in the coming weeks.
“A highly requested feature, you can now link your phone as one of up to four additional devices, just as you can with WhatsApp on web browsers, tablets, and desktops.
“Each linked phone connects to WhatsApp independently, ensuring end-to-end encryption of your messages, media, and calls,” WhatsApp said in a blog post on Tuesday.
Furthermore, users can now switch between phones without signing out and resume conversations where they left off.
Furthermore, if you own a small business, additional employees will now be able to respond to customers directly from their phones using the same WhatsApp Business account, according to the company.
